Just in time for the upcoming political conventions and next year’s presidential election, the Cheng Library is pleased to introduce two new resources for published research on politics and public affairs: Political Science Complete and Public Affairs Index.
Political Science Complete provides access to full-text sources that include nearly 480 journals (of which 262 are unique to this database), 330 full-text reference books and the 35,000-plus conference papers from many major political science associations.
Given the multidisciplinary nature of politics, this resource provides extensive coverage of global politics with an expansive focus. The database also captures the scope of political studies from both the national and international perspectives. The subjects covered include comparative politics, international relations, humanitarian issues, law and legislation, non-governmental organizations, and political theory.
The content draws from scholarly, professional, and peer-reviewed sources. It also includes notable popular sources such as The Nation, Commentary and Policy and Perspectives.
Public Affairs Index, a bibliographic database, covers all aspects of contemporary public policy from the national and international points of view. These issues range from public health, the environment, housing, human and civil rights, to international commerce and conflict.
This resource encompasses a wide variety of materials for researchers and students. The database contains a diverse collection of sources including scholarly journals, conference papers, trade publications and government documents. These publications provide up-to-date information on a wide range of topics of concern in the world today.
Together, these resources provide comprehensive access to the research literature, reports, news, and other expert analyses of politics and public affairs.
